AJW Group becomes a signatory of United Nations Global Compact

By PAX International Staff

Christopher Whiteside, Chairman of AJW Group

AJW Group, an independent supply chain solutions provider to the aviation industry, specialising in component supply and repair, announces its commitment to implement universal sustainability principles and to take steps to support UN goals with its participation in the United Nations Global Compact (UNGC), the world’s largest global corporate sustainability initiative.

In a March 6 press release, Christopher Whiteside, Chairman of AJW Group, said, “Announcing our participation in the UN Global Contract is a pivotal moment for our company, one our founder would be proud of. This heralds a new era of commitment to sustainability as we fly towards our centenary in 2032.”

The UNGC’s vision is to “mobilise a global movement of sustainable companies and stakeholders to create the world we want.” It has implemented a strategy to drive business awareness and action in support of achieving the Sustainable Development Goals by 2030.

To make this happen, it supports AJW Group in its continuing efforts to operate the business responsibly, aligning its strategies and operations with the UNGC's Ten Principles on human rights, labour, environment, and anti-corruption. It will take strategic actions to advance broader societal goals, such as the UN Sustainable Development Goals, with an emphasis on collaboration and innovation.

AJW is committed to sustainable business practices and is participating in the UNGC as part of its efforts to bring about a more earth and people-friendly aviation industry. By signing the declaration, the Group hopes others will follow suit, and together industry stakeholders can unite for the good of the planet, its people, and its communities.
